George Kingsley Zipf was an American linguist and philologist known for his work in the field of statistical linguistics. He is best known for Zipf's law, which describes the frequency distribution of words in a language, suggesting that the frequency of any word is inversely proportional to its rank in the frequency table. His research laid the groundwork for understanding the efficiency of language and communication systems, influencing various fields, including linguistics, sociology, and information theory.
